Transaction 23f75927417d2ed69f5720e3f7e0e8c30685531b7d21931cb4251c58c4357a30
1 Input
1 Output
-
23f75927417d2ed69f5720e3f7e0e8c30685531b7d21931cb4251c58c4357a30:0
- value
- 314570
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b2d79b81e911fd82b414b3ae2bae9a988b0e559 OP_EQUAL
- address
- 375vGYzrbeGjFfNXTUeD5iNvhdBfpfiaQ9